Half Life 2 Played Using The Wiimote

December 6th, 2006 by Darren Stevens in Action, Adventure, Gear, Hardware, Offbeat, Online, Software, Technology, Wii

Someone has made it possible to use the Wiimote on a PC to play Half Life 2, with the help of a Macbook Pro and a Bluetooth module. While the sensitivity is far off, the other controls seem to work fine, you can fire and reload, and you can change weapons using the D-pad. To jump, you simply flick the Wiimote upwards.
